This is true, people don't seem to take in the cost of running a mining rig. The parts are just one piece of the puzzle, you also need to think about the cost of electricity which can actually cost you more than the yield of the return you get back thus always putting you at a loss, you are essentially losing money by running an independent mining machine.

It's also not beneficial to mine Bitcoin anymore for several reason: 1) being the power draw is too high for domestic/commercial users. 2) liquidity pools have an advantage over single miner's. 3) big corporations have multiple mining rigs setup in their own liquidity pools and they don't care about the electricity bill. 4) Bitcoin is near it's market cap, meaning there's only 'x' amount of coins left to give out and that's it, no more can be mined.

Trouble is these calculations are taking so long now the closer we are to the end that its drawing too much power even with linked computers that it's actually now having a negative effect on the environment

You are at a HUGE disadvantage mining right now for a WHOLE coin, it's virtually impossible...shit coins/alt-coins sure, but not BTC or ETH they are pretty much conquered by big companies or small pools from crypto enthusiast communities.
